Basudevpur, July 3: A major breach occurred in the Koper Dam of the ongoing Kanupur Irrigation Project in Basudevpur Block, raising serious concerns of flooding.
The breach was found in the construction of the main dam, and floodwaters have started to flow over it.
The situation has worsened as floodwaters are now threatening the lower areas of the Baitarani River, with towns like Anandapur and Akhuapada facing an increased risk of flooding. The local administration has issued warnings to the residents and has stepped up precautionary measures.
The Koper Dam, which is being constructed to regulate water flow for the irrigation project, had its spillway gates temporarily sealed with soil during the construction process.
The project was initially slated for completion by the end of July, but with this breach, the administration is closely monitoring the situation.
Residents are being advised to stay alert and follow instructions from local authorities as the floodwaters continue to rise.
Efforts to repair the breach and prevent further damage are underway.
